The one and only water lens is achieved by utilizing surface tension, dripping a waterdrop in the hole
of a Japanese five-yen-coin. Water lenses are fragile: they tremble in the wind, break by the touch
of a finger, but yet universal, watching the world as a dew on a leaf, or a drip from a faucet,
or water inside you. Adapted from poet fukudapero's singular poetry, we have made a 5 minutes film
by collecting visions of waterdrops of our ordinary world.
